본문 바로가기

라즈베리파이/NAS

NAS[7] - OMV5에 SFTP설치하기

반응형

안녕하세요.

오늘은 OMV5에 SFTP를 설치해보도록 하겠습니다.

 

1. 개요

(1) SFTP란?

SFTP는 원격으로 파일에 접근할 수 있는 프로토콜 중 하나입니다.

SAMBA는 내부 네트워크에서만 파일 공유가 가능하고, FTP는 보안 위험이 큰데, SFTP는 저런 단점들을 모두 커버할 수 있습니다.

 

(2) SSH 활성화하기

SFTP는 SSH기반의 기술이므로 SSH를 활성화시켜주어야 사용이 가능합니다.

좌측의 [서비스]-[SSH]탭으로 진입하신 후 SSH를 활성화시켜주세요.

이제 SSH권한을 설정해주도록 하겠습니다.

좌측의 [접근 권한 관리]-[사용자]탭으로 들어가주세요.

 

SFTP에 사용할 사용자 계정을 선택하신 후 상단의 [편집] 버튼을 눌러주신 후 다음과 같이 [그룹]탭의 ssh항목에 체크하신 후 저장해주세요.

 

2. SFTP 설치하기

SFTP는 도커가 아니라 플러그인으로 설치하게 됩니다.

좌측의 [시스템]-[플러그인]탭으로 들어가주세요.

상단의 검색창에 sftp라고 검색하시면 다음과 같은 항목이 검색됩니다.

해당 항목의 체크박스를 클릭하시고, 상단의 [+설치]버튼을 눌러주세요.

설치가 완료되면 [닫기]버튼을 눌러줍니다.

그럼 아래와 같이 새로고침 안내 페이지가 뜨는데 [확인]버튼을 눌러주시면 자동으로 페이지가 새로고침됩니다.

새로고침이 완료되면 좌측의 [서비스]탭에 SFTP항목이 뜰텐데, 해당 항목으로 들어가주세요.

[SFTP]항목으로 진입하셨다면, 상단의 [Access List]탭으로 들어가신 후 [+추가]버튼을 눌러줍니다.

SFTP를 활용할 사용자 계정을 선택하신 후, 공유하실 폴더를 선택해주세요.

저장 후 적용까지 마치신 후 다시 상단의 [설정]탭으로 들어가셔서 활성화 시켜줍니다.

 

3. 파일 공유 클라이언트 프로그램 설치하기

SFTP에 연결하기 위해서는 별도의 파일공유 프로그램이 필요합니다.

여기서는 FileZila를 설치하여 사용해보도록 하겠습니다.

 

우선 아래 링크에 접속하여, 본인의 운영체제에 맞는 프로그램을 설치해줍니다.

filezilla-project.org/download.php?show_all=1

 

Download FileZilla Client

Download FileZilla Client The latest stable version of FileZilla Client is 3.51.0 Please select the file appropriate for your platform below. Windows (64bit) FileZilla_3.51.0_win64-setup.exe (recommended) Size: 11312288 bytes SHA-512 hash: 2d0cd7c9775315d7

filezilla-project.org

저의 경우는 64비트 윈도우를 사용하고 있으므로 다음 파일을 설치해주었습니다.

설치파일을 다운받으시면 그냥 쭉쭉 넘겨주시면 자동으로 설치됩니다.

파일질라를 실행해주시고, 상단의 빠른연결바에 다음과 같이 정보를 채워넣어줍니다.

호스트는 OMV5가 설치된 라즈베리파이의 IP주소를 입력해주세요.

사용자명은 아까 SFTP를 설정할때 선택하신 사용자 계정명을 입력해주시면 됩니다.

포트는 22번으로 설정해주세요.

입력을 마치고 [빠른 연결]버튼을 누르시면 다음과 같은 창이 뜹니다.

그냥 [확인]버튼을 누르시면 연결이 진행됩니다.

두개의 탐색기 중 오른쪽의 탐색기에 다음과 같이 라즈베리파이의 디렉터리들이 보이신다면 정상적으로 연결된 것입니다.

파일 전송은 다음과 같이 원하는 파일을 오른쪽 클릭하신 후, [업로드]버튼을 눌러주시면 됩니다.

반응형